Infernus vs Mo & Krill Matchup Summary

The Infernus vs Mo & Krill matchup in Deadlock is a moderately favorable matchup. Based on 10,950 recent matches analyzed, Mo & Krill wins with a 51.8% win rate compared to Infernus's 48.1%, giving Mo & Krill a 3.7 percentage point advantage. The most significant statistical gap is in objective contribution, where Infernus consistently outperforms. Mo & Krill holds a meaningful advantage in this matchup. Infernus players should play more cautiously, prioritize safe farming, and look for team fight opportunities where positioning and coordination matter more than 1v1 statistics.

Infernus vs Mo & Krill Economy Analysis

Net Worth
44,364Infernus
43,010Mo & Krill
Last Hits
101.6Infernus
83.7Mo & Krill

Infernus generates approximately 1,354 more souls than Mo & Krill on average. This moderate economic edge translates to earlier power spikes and item completions, giving Infernus a mid-game advantage. Infernus secures more last hits (101.6 vs 83.7), while Infernus leads in denies (3.5 vs 3.1). These farming dynamics shape the lane equilibrium and gold distribution.

Infernus Matchups - FAQ

What is Infernus's best matchup in Deadlock?

Infernus's best matchup is against Mirage, achieving a 55.4% win rate. Infernus excels in this matchup through superior combat stats and favorable ability interactions.

What is Infernus's hardest matchup?

Infernus's hardest matchup is against Victor, with only a 43.3% win rate. Against this opponent, Infernus should focus on team coordination and itemizing defensively.

How many favorable matchups does Infernus have?

Infernus has 19 favorable matchups (50%+ win rate) and 18 unfavorable matchups in Deadlock. Understanding these matchup dynamics helps you make better hero picks and adapt your playstyle.
